The Screening Of Metastatic-related Genes In MiR-199a Regulated Melanoma Cells

Objective:By screening the tumor metastatic-related genes in miR-199a-regulated B16F10 melanoma cells with tumor metastatic PCR array, we mean to find more about the metastatic mechanism of melanoma and provide theoretic foundation for future research.Methods:To Construct miR-199a over-expressed plasmid and inhibitor, then transfer them to highly metastatic melanoma cells (B16F10) by gene transfer technology. As a result, miR-199a is highly or lowly expressed. After extracting RNA from the melanoma cells, we analyze the RNA samples with ultraviolet spectrophotometer and denatured agarose gel electrophoresis. Then we sent the RNA samples for tumor metastatic PCR array for screening the differently expressed metastatic genes (accomplished by Kangcheng biological industrial corporation in Shanghai). Then we pick out 2 or 3 differently expressed genes to do the confirmatory experiment through RT-PCR and agarose gel electrophoresis.Results:1. The RNA data shows the A260/A280 ratio is among 1.8 and 2.1,which means the RNA purity is qualified for the following experiment. The electrophoresis diaphragm also confirmed the purity of the RNA sample.2.Analyze the RNA sample with tumor metastatic PCR array: compare the inhibitor group to the overexpressed group,12 genes are up-regulated:Cd44,Cdh1,Cxcr4,Etv4,Fxyd5,Rpsa,Mmp3,Myc,Rb1,Tcf20,Hprt1,Actb1,3 genes are down-regulated:Ctsk,Itga7,Tnfsf10;Compare the inhibitor group to the blank group,14 genes are up-regulated:Cxc4,Ctbp1,Rpsa,Myc11,Mmp3,Mmp13,Kiss1r,Hgf,Htatip2,â…¡18,â…¡8rb,Cd82,Kiss1,Timp4, no genes are down-regulated significantly; compare the overexpressed group to the blank group,17genes up regulated:Cxcr4,Ctsk,Csf1,Ela2,Mmp3, Mmp13,P2ry5,Kiss1r,Hgf,Hras1,Htatip2,â…¡18,â…¡8rb,Kiss1,Timp4,Itga7,Tnfsf10,7 genes down regulated:Cdh1,Etv4,Fxyd5,Myc,Nme2,Rb1,Hprt1.3. Confirm the related gene expression with RT-PCR and agarose gel electrophoresis:Choose Myc and Tnfsf10 to do the confirmatory experiment among the differently expressed genes according to the PCR array data. The electrophoresis diaphragm is supportive of the previous experiment.Conclusions:Among the miR-199a-regulated melanoma genes, the potential genes related to up-regulation of melanoma metastasis are: Cd44,Cdh1,Ctbp1,Etv4,Fxyd5,Rpsa,Myc11,Myc,Nme2,Cd82,Rb1,Tcf20,Hprt1,Actb1; the potential genes related to down-regulation of melanoma metastasis are:Ctsk,Csf1,Ela2,P2ry5,Hras1,Ctsk,Itga7,Tnfsf10. According to our RT-PCR results, Myc is negatively regulated by miR-199a; while TnfsflO is positively regulated by miR-199a.
